In an exciting move to enhance tourism, Russia is looking to make itself more accessible to Vietnamese travelers in 2026 by revising its visa policies and implementing new tourism initiatives. The Russian government, through the Ministry of Economic Development and the Federal Agency for Tourism, is focusing on easing entry barriers, including the potential for visa-free travel for organized tour groups. This push aims to increase the number of visitors from Vietnam while promoting Russia’s top destinations, cultural landmarks, and natural beauty to the Southeast Asian market.

Currently, around 15,000 Vietnamese tourists visit Russia annually, a modest number compared to the 600,000 Russians who travel to Vietnam each year. This disparity highlights a significant opportunity for Russia to boost its tourism presence in Southeast Asia, especially as it seeks to diversify its visitor base beyond traditional European markets.

Simplifying Travel for Vietnamese Tourists

To address the growing interest in Russia as a travel destination, the government has introduced several key measures designed to make the travel process smoother for Vietnamese tourists. The most significant of these is the possible visa-free entry for organized tour groups, which would simplify travel for groups of Vietnamese tourists planning to visit Russia. This change is expected to eliminate bureaucratic hurdles and provide a more streamlined experience for travelers.

Discover Russia Campaign: A Central Marketing Strategy

One of the central components of Russia’s efforts to attract Vietnamese tourists is the Discover Russia initiative. This program consolidates various regional tourism campaigns, spotlighting Russia’s top destinations and cultural offerings. The initiative aims to raise awareness about Russia’s diverse tourism options—from the vibrant city life of Moscow and St. Petersburg to the stunning landscapes of Lake Baikal and Kamchatka.

The Discover Russia initiative is designed to target travelers in Southeast Asia, with a special focus on Vietnam due to the strong historical ties between the two countries. The program is expected to include marketing campaigns, digital outreach, and participation in travel expos and forums, all designed to encourage Vietnamese citizens to explore Russia’s cultural and natural offerings.
